there are number of 3G cellphones that you will get within the range of $300-$400. i'm suggesting few cellphones within your range with cool functions and stylish looks. these are, *Nokia E90-The Nokia E90 Communicator features a slide-out full QWERTY keyboard, and it features the 3G network. Make video calls from your phone, and listen or watch your favorite media, including MP3 and videos. It features a large inner display at 800-by-352 pixels and a 240-by-320 pixel external display. It features GPS and an Internet. *Samsung L870- The Samsung SGH-L870 comes with 100MB of internal memory with a microSD card slot, which can hold up to 8GB of additional data. It features a slide-out QWERTY keyboard and a 2.4-inch display. It comes with the Symbian OS version 9.3 and a 32-bit processor. This phone gives you nearly four hours of talk time and 222 hours of standby time. As of 2010, this phone costs approximately $400.*LG KT610- The top of this phone flips open to expose the QWERTY keyboard, and it comes with 64MB of internal memory. It comes with Bluetooth connectivity, and it features the Symbian OS v9.2 operating system. The phone is completely black with white, black and blue lettering. It keeps detailed call records of your phone calls for up to 30 days. As of 2010, this phone costs approximately $300. *Nokia 6210- The Nokia 6210 Navigator comes with a turn-by-turn directions feature that finds your current location and then directs you to your destination. this phone costs about $400.
